Olathe North had already won six in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 21.5 points) and they went ahead and made it seven on Friday. They breezed past the Olathe East Hawks to the tune of 63-33. That result was just more of the same for these two, as the Eagles also won the last time the pair played back in February of 2024.
Olathe North's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Asia Lee led the charge by going 6-for-10 to rack up 17 points and five rebounds. What's more, Lee posted three assists, the most she's had since back in January of 2024. Another player making a difference was Allie Workman, who went 5-for-8 on her way to 16 points.
Olathe North sm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 18 offensive rebounds.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now pulled down at least 12 offensive boards in five consecutive matchups.
Olathe North's win was their third stra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 13-5. As for Olathe East, they are on a seven-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 5-15.
Looking ahead, Olathe North will head out on the road to take on Mill Valley at 5: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Olathe North knows how to get points on the board -- the squad has finished with 55 points or more in their past four games -- so hopefully Mill Valley likes a good challenge. As for Olathe East, they will face off against Gardner-Edgerton on Tuesday. Gardner-Edgerton has been getting the ball to fall more lately as they've increased their point totals each of their last three games.
